Function keys in a laptop greatly depends on the BIOS setup of the machine. For your ASUS laptop kindly check out below options.

1. In Grub press "e" and go to the line starting with "linux" . At the end of "queit splash" append "acpi_osi=Linux acpi_backlight=vendor " . Press ctlr+X and start the machine. Now check for the brightness key .

2. Open terminal and install package xbacklight
sudo apt-get install xbacklight
Once it is installed , run "xbacklight -set 50" . If this reduces the brightness of the monitor, then we can map it with the function key accordingly.

Also send the output of "lspci -vv" and "lshw -html"
